Burnley bring in defender Edgar

Published: 01 Jul 2009 - 13:55:54

Burnley manger Owen Coyle has added defender David Edgar to his squad after his contract with Newcastle expired. The 22-year-old Canadian defender has signed a four-year deal with the newly promoted Premier League side. His age means that Burnley will have to agree a fee to compensate the Magpies for the switch.
